文章簡介:如何理解和應用MySQLMVCC原理引言:MySQL是一種常用的關聯式資料庫管理系統,它採用了MVCC(Multi-VersionConcurrencyControl)原理來保證資料的一致性和並發性。 MVCC是一種事務並發控制方法,它基於版本管理來實現對資料的讀寫操作。本文將介紹MVCC原理的基本概念以及如何在MySQL中應用MVCC。一、MVCC原
2023-09-09 評論 0 996
文章簡介:一、概述:MVCC,全名為Multi-VersionConcurrencyControl,即多版本並發控制。 MVCC是一種多並發控制的方法,一般在資料庫管理系統中,實現對資料庫的並發訪問,在程式語言中實現事務記憶體。我們知道,MySql在5.5後由MyISAM儲存引擎改成了InnoDB儲存引擎,主要是因為InnoDB是支援事務的,那麼當多執行緒同時執行的時候,可能會出現並發問題。這個時候可能會出現一個能夠控制並發的方法,MVCC就起到了這個作用。 MVCC主要靠undolog版本鏈與ReadView來實
2023-06-03 評論 0 1667
文章簡介:這篇文章帶大家了解MVCC,介紹一下MVCC與隔離等級的關係,從設計的角度上,聊聊為什麼要設計出MVCC,且RC和RR的隔離等級到底有什麼不同。
2022-03-11 評論 0 3039
文章簡介:MySQLMVCC原理分析與應用指南摘要:MySQL是一款非常流行的關聯式資料庫管理系統,具有並發效能好的特性。這得歸功於MySQL的多版本並發控制(MVCC)技術。本文將深入探討MySQLMVCC的原理,並提供一些實際應用場景的指南。介紹MVCC是一種用於控制資料庫並發存取的技術。 MySQL使用了基於MVCC的儲存引擎,如InnoDB,它在事務並發控制
2023-09-09 評論 0 1051
文章簡介:這篇文章為大家帶來了關於mysql的相關知識,其中主要介紹了關於InnoDB之MVCC原理的相關問題,MVCC即多版本並發控制,主要是為了提高數據庫的並發性能,下面一起來看一下,希望對大家有幫助。
2022-04-18 評論 0 2058
文章簡介:mysql資料庫欄位介紹認識InnoDB MVCC如何運作的。
2020-10-10 評論 0 1815
文章簡介:這篇文章帶給大家的內容是關於MySQL的MVCC的用法介紹,有一定的參考價值,有需要的朋友可以參考一下,希望對你有幫助。
2019-03-22 評論 0 4088
文章簡介:MySQL是一種常用的關聯式資料庫管理系統,被廣泛應用於各種應用。在MySQL中,MVCC(Multi-VersionConcurrencyControl)是一種用於實現並發控制和事務隔離的機制。本文將剖析MySQLMVCC的原理,並提供一些效能最佳化策略,以提升資料庫的效能。 MVCC的原理MVCC是透過在每個資料庫行內維護多個版本的數據
2023-09-09 評論 0 1202
文章簡介:MySQLMVCC原理深入解讀及最佳實務一、概述MySQL是使用最廣泛的關聯式資料庫管理系統之一,其支援多版本並發控制(Multi-VersionConcurrencyControl,MVCC)機制來處理並發存取問題。本文將深入解讀MySQLMVCC的原理,並舉出一些最佳實務的範例。二、MVCC原理版本號MVCC是透過為每個資料行增加額外
2023-09-09 評論 0 1267